    Intelligence Quotient Test: Perceptions vs. Realities among Undergraduate Students
    Author(s): Ochilbek Rakhmanov and Senol Dane*

    Introduction: IQ test continue to be one of most reliable tools to measure intelligence skills of the human. Method: In this paper, the different types of perceptions of the undergraduate students were compared to their real full scale IQ scores. Results: Results show that students overrate or underrate their IQ skills. Students with lower IQ scores tend to believe that this may affect their academic and future job performance.
